Your TV signal is switching to "digital." For more than fifty years, TV broadcasters have sent their shows to your TV using "analog" signals. After February 17, 2009, most of the old analog signals will be gone and most of the stations you watch will use only the new digital signals.
If you have an analog-only TV with a rooftop antenna or "rabbit ears," you will not be able to watch most TV stations after February 17, 2009 unless you get a "converter box."See the full content of this document
